Hebrew word study

קוּטqûwṭ properly, to cut off, i.e. (figuratively) detest

Pronounced “koot

properly, to cut off, i.e. (figuratively) detest

Translated in the King James as: begrieved, loathe self.

Appears 6 times in Scripture

Origin: a primitive root;

Read it in context & ask Abram about this word

Where it appears

Psalms 3×
Psalms 95:10Psalms 119:158Psalms 139:21
Ezekiel 3×
Ezekiel 6:9Ezekiel 20:43Ezekiel 36:31
